Comcast is breaking up with NBCU. Why did it ever buy it in the first place?
Comcast's decision to split into separate broadband and NBCUniversal entertainment entities marks a significant restructuring in the media landscape. This move reflects a strategic shift to focus on distinct business operations and could enhance the operational efficiency of both divisions. Historically, Comcast's acquisition of NBCU was driven by the potential to create a powerful media and entertainment conglomerate, but the new separation suggests a reevaluation of that strategy in light of evolving market dynamics and regulatory scrutiny.
